Fórum Ubuntu CZ/SK

Ubuntu pro osobní počítače => Software => Příkazový řádek a programování pro GNU/Linux => Téma založeno: sajmon 28 Září 2012, 22:17:01

Název: Software na C - spustenie zdrojáku
Přispěvatel: sajmon 28 Září 2012, 22:17:01
Ahojte,
na Win som používal pre jazyk C software Dev++, teraz keď som prešiel na linux chcel by som použiť niečo podobné, tým myslím že po napísaní celého zdrojáku mi po stalačení klávesy (napr. F9) skompiluje aj spustí daný zdroják (čítal som, že v linuxe sa to zväčša robí cez príkaz v terminály, ale to by som nechcel moc robiť).

Takže stiahol som si Anjutu, Geany. No dokážem zdroják len skompilovať a nie aj spustiť . Čo preto treba nastaviť poprípade, čo si potrebujem ešte doinštalovať ??
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: Martin - ViPEr*CZ* 28 Září 2012, 22:36:43
Záleží co a v čem chcete dělat. No mělo by jít spouštět... těžko říct co děláte blbě. Samozřejmě chce vždy založit celý projekt a ne jen cpp file, aby šlo spouštět. Taktéž je možné vyzkoušet ještě další IDE co Vám bude více vyhovovat. Například takové univerzální Netbeans a nebo pro KDE KDevelop či QtCreator.
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: sajmon 28 Září 2012, 23:54:58
môžem mať aj problém v tom, že nevytváram nové projekty ale len čisto otvorím zdrojový kód a snažím sa ho kompilovať a spustiť ??
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: sajmon 29 Září 2012, 10:21:10
dobre spustil som si cez Wine DevC++, len opäť mi neotvorí konzolu s výstupom,
ale keď spustím Dev-ko vo Win7 s tým istým zdorjákom, tak výstup prebehne bez problémov.
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: Martin - ViPEr*CZ* 29 Září 2012, 10:34:05
dobre spustil som si cez Wine DevC++, len opäť mi neotvorí konzolu s výstupom,
ale keď spustím Dev-ko vo Win7 s tým istým zdorjákom, tak výstup prebehne bez problémov.
Dělat vývoj na linuxu přes wine je defakto nesmysl. Samozřejmě pokud otevřete jen zdroják a kompilujete (to jsem psal hned na začátku), tak se vám to s největší pravděpodobností nespustí. Založte celý projekt, vytvořte si například pro pokus aplikaci "Hallo world" a zkuste spustit.
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: TIBOR 29 Září 2012, 10:47:07
V anjuta si napises program ulozis ho ako nazov.c . Cez zostavit-zostavit ( F7 ) ho zkompilujes. Potom ides do run-program parameter a tam nastavis cestu k spustitelnemu suboru aj s nazvom suboru. Ten nazov je dolezity ak si kompiloval iny program ako pred tym. Spustis ho cez Run-execute ( F3 ).
Program sa ti spusti v integrovanom terminale. Ak ten terminal nevypnes pred dalsim spustenym tak sa ti spusti dalsi terminal zo systemu.

Pisem o jednoduchom programe nie projekte.
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: libcosenior 29 Září 2012, 10:54:31
sajmon, vyskúšaj code::blocks, celkom dobre sa s ním robí.
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: Martin - ViPEr*CZ* 29 Září 2012, 11:04:08
Podle mě je lepší návyk dělat (zakládat) si rovnou projekty. Pamatovat si nějaké extra nastavení cesty k programu, kterej jsem před chvíli skompiloval, abych ho mohl spustit je opruz navíc.
Název: Re:Software na C - spustenie zdrojáku
Přispěvatel: sajmon 29 Září 2012, 12:02:17
V anjuta si napises program ulozis ho ako nazov.c . Cez zostavit-zostavit ( F7 ) ho zkompilujes. Potom ides do run-program parameter a tam nastavis cestu k spustitelnemu suboru aj s nazvom suboru. Ten nazov je dolezity ak si kompiloval iny program ako pred tym. Spustis ho cez Run-execute ( F3 ).
Program sa ti spusti v integrovanom terminale. Ak ten terminal nevypnes pred dalsim spustenym tak sa ti spusti dalsi terminal zo systemu.

Pisem o jednoduchom programe nie projekte.

presne toto som chcel, dík. Nevedel som čo dať do tých parametrov

sajmon, vyskúšaj code::blocks, celkom dobre sa s ním robí.

už mám nainštalovaný a tam mi to funguje, dík